Q: Is 6,651,340 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,651,340 is a composite number.

Why is 6,651,340 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,651,340 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 20 332,567 665,134 1,330,268 1,662,835 3,325,670 and 6,651,340, with no remainder.

Since 6,651,340 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,651,340, it is a composite number.
